DESCRIPTION: Trifluridine Ophthalmic Solution (also known as trifluorothymidine, F 3 TdR, F 3 T), an antiviral drug for topical treatment of epithelial keratitis caused by herpes simplex virus. The chemical name of trifluridine is α,α,α-trifluorothymidine. Trifluridine has the following structural formula.
